Breyers Mint Chocolate Gelato Indulgences
Mint Gelato with a rich fudge swirl & gourmet chocolate curls

It's pretty, but like the others, the curls are mostly flavorless.

I can sum this one up real easy: Nick will hate it. He hates that buttermint vibe and the almost rubbery texture of breyers gelato amplifies it in a way that he would not appreciate.

I will admit, the fudge swirl is a nice touch and probably the highlight here. In fact, it's good enough that if you can ignore the gelato texture, I can see some people liking this product.... maybe. Well, we already know some people like it (many of whom have never tried Talenti or Gelato Fiasco), but this minty flavor is a common sense addition to their current line up.

The weird thing is some bites feel like you're eating mini marshmallows.

Ok, I'm flip flopping back and forth as I eat this one..... I am still eating it, despite the lack of words coming to me right now. Ok, how's this? it's nothing I would buy again. I just still really don't like their gelato texture. It's Italian frozen dairy dessert and nothing I would purposely seek out.

Time to check in with my daughter: she says the mint isn't bad, but says the fudge swirl tastes weird... so I take a few bites and I get what she's driving at. She wanted fudge swirl, but this is more... gee, maybe more cocoa-y then that? And the texutre is a bit rubbery as well. She usually likes these minty flavors but pretty sure I'll be buying something more traditional next time I want mint.

On Second Scoop:  I had a bit more and while this isn't terrible, I don't know why you would pick it over the dozens of other minty choices out there that have better texture and a cleaner flavor. There's not even really that minty tingle you get with better flavors. This one is just kind of mute and gummy.
